Wheatley Heights
Wheatley Heights is a hamlet and census-designated place located within the Town of Babylon, in Suffolk County, on Long Island, New York, United States.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Wyandanch is a station along the Main Line of the Long Island Rail Road. It is located on Straight Path and Long Island Avenue, off Acorn Avenue, in Wyandanch, New York, United States.

Wyandanch is a hamlet and census-designated place in the Town of Babylon in Suffolk County, New York, United States. The population was 12,990 at the time of 2020 census.

Deer Park is a hamlet and census-designated place in the Town of Babylon, in Suffolk County, on Long Island, in New York, United States. The population was listed as 28,837 at the time of the 2020 census. Deer Park is situated 2 miles east of Wheatley Heights.

Melville is an affluent hamlet and census-designated place in the Town of Huntington in Suffolk County, on Long Island, in New York, United States. The population was 19,284 at the time of the 2020 census. Melville is situated 3 miles northwest of Wheatley Heights.
